These muscles work automatically without stopping, day and night. They are similar in structure to the skeletal muscles, so doctors sometimes classify them as striated muscles. The cardiac muscles contract so that the … Zobraziť viac Skeletal muscles move the external parts of the body and the limbs. They cover the bones and give the body its shape. As skeletal muscles only pull in one direction, they work in pairs.
